304 - Premises not free of pests [s. 26(a)]
Observation: Rodent droppings found on three shelves in downstairs basement dry storage area.
NOTE: Health inspector unable to find holes
.
Corrective Action(s): Pull all items off shelves
Clean and sanitize shelves with 200ppm Chlorine or equivalent.
Set up traps in this room.
Have Pest Technician inspect room for entry points.
.
Violation Score: 3

COMPLIANCE REQUIREMENTS FOR FOOD PREPARED, SERVED OR OFFERED FOR SALE LOCATED ON THE PREMISES OF A BC FOOD SERVICE ESTABLISHMENT:




Compliance

Date to be corrected by


1.

Documentation for food is kept on site and provided to the EHO upon request.

Yes



2.

All soft spreadable margarine and oil meets the restriction of 2% trans fat or less of total fat content.

Yes



3.

All other food meets the restriction of 5% trans fat or less of total fat content.

Yes

Time Spent: 0.25 hour
Specific comments:
Food exempt from the regulation includes:
  • Pre-packaged food with a Nutrition Facts table sold directly to the consumer without alteration
  • Food with the sole source(s) as naturally occurring trans fat (i.e. beef, sheep, lamb, bison and dairy products)
  • Employee lunches not purchased from the food service establishment
